1) Vikings Shutdown Next Starter for 4 Games: Very tough news. Making matters even worse is that Ryan Kelly has already picked up a concussion in 2025, making the current one even more concerning. Health — both in a short-term and long-term capacity — is what’s most important.

3) Almost Quietly, The Vikings Said Goodbye to a Quarterback: Unless something truly unusual happened, Desmond Ridder was always going to be around on a short-term basis. He jumped onto Minnesota’s roster to offer quarterback depth while J.J. McCarthy healed.

4) Ex-Vikings QB Axed After Trade: Not too surprising, all things considered. Brett Rypien is far from the NFL’s most impressive passer. The struggles over in Cincinnati point toward the need for change, so the depth quarterback is a scapegoat even though he’s far from the reason why the team is underwhelming.
